The poll is not asking for a preference.  It is an objective measurement.  You measure your bow string and that is enter it into the poll.  

Bows that are the same length could very well have different brace heights.  So the bottom line is the string length and for a string maker that is the measurement needed.

I make a lot of bowstrings and it really is not subjective. You make a recurve string 4 inches shorter than the bow and 3 inches shorter for a longbow.
